Reverse Osmosis Installation in Richmond, VA
Reverse osmosis installation services provide homeowners with a reliable method for improving the quality of their drinking water. This process involves setting up a specialized filtration system that u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ove contaminants, sediments, and impurities from tap water. Projects typically include installing systems under kitchen sinks, in basements, or as part of whole-house water treatment setups, ensuring clean, great-tasting water throughout the property.
Property owners interested in reverse osmosis systems usually want to understand the system’s capacity, maintenance needs, and how it fits into their existing plumbing. It’s also common to inquire about the types of contaminants it can remove, the space required for installation, and any impact on water pressure or flow. Having clear information about these aspects can help homeowners determine if a reverse osmosis system aligns with their water quality goals and household needs.

Reverse Osmosis Installation Questions
What is reverse osmosis water filtration? Reverse osmosis is a process that removes contaminants and impurities from tap water, providing cleaner and better-tasting water for household use.
What types of property projects typically require reverse osmosis installation? Reverse osmosis is commonly installed in homes with concerns about water quality, or in properties needing purified water for drinking, cooking, or appliances.
How does the installation process work? The process involves connecting a filtration system to the existing water supply, usually under the sink or at the main line, to ensure purified water is accessible throughout the property.
What should property owners consider before installing reverse osmosis systems? It’s important to evaluate water quality, available space for the system, and the specific filtration needs to choose the right setup for the property.
